Elektroda.pl
Elektroda.pl
X
Proszę, dodaj wyjątek dla www.elektroda.pl do Adblock.
Dzięki temu, że oglądasz reklamy, wspierasz portal i użytkowników.

pilot i odbiornik ir z tunera sat - RC5?

30 Wrz 2005 21:11 2998 14
  • Poziom 14  
    Witam!

    Mam problem z napisaniem obsługi pilota. Pilot i odbiornik mam z odzysku z tunera sat Sabre. Odbiornik to Sony SBX1620-E2 2k2, w metalowj obudowie z trzema nóżkami. Jak był jeszcze w tunerze to sprawdziłem miernikiem na której nodze jest masa, zasilanie i sygnał, więc myślę, że na pewno podłączyłem dobrze do mikrokontrolera (atmega8, pin d2(int0)). Na początku napisałem prosty program w c z tutoriala avr, który tylko pokazywał czy odbiera jakiś sygnał. Program reagował na dowolne przyciski z pilota, reagował także na pilot od cd technicsa. Wziełem się więc za dekodowanie sygnału i tu pojawił się problem :( Znalazłem program do dekodowania rc5 - http://markh.de/software/rc5dec.c Program niestety nie działa. Próbowałem go modyfikować na różne sposoby, jednak nic z tego nie wyszło. Dlatego zastanawiam się czy ten pilot nadaje w rc5? Czy mógłby mi ktoś pomóc z programem, przydałby mi się jakiś sprawdzony program (w C), który na pewno działa. Pomożecie mi z tym pilotem?
  • Pomocny post
    Poziom 23  
    Sprawdź jaki układ scalony pracuje w pilocie. Jeśli to SAA3006, SAA3010 , SAA3027 , PCA8521 to na pewno nadaje w kodzie RC5.

    Jeśli żaden z powyższych to spisz jego nazwę i poszukaj informacji na jego temat na google, a na pewno dowiesz się czy pilot pracuje w RC5.
  • Poziom 14  
    siedzi tam układ NEC D6124, więc nie jest to rc5. Dziękuję za link do materiałów, biorę się za pisanie kodu :) Mam nadzieję, że dam sobie radę. Jak nie to będę pytał :)
  • Pomocny post
    Poziom 23  
    Ten układ nadaje w standardzie Sony.
  • Poziom 14  
    to jak w końcu? To jest sirc czy nec?
    tu jest nota katalogowa, ale jakoś nic nie moge tam znaleźć na ten temat:
    http://elenota.iele.polsl.gliwice.pl/pdf/NEC/upd6124a.pdf

    Jest tam tylko to:
    "To use the NEC transmission format, ask NEC to supply the custom code."
    Czyli ja rozumiem to tak, że generalnie nadaje w innym formacie, ale na życzenie może nadawać w NECu.
    Zanim zaczne pisac towole być pewny jaki to protokół.
  • Pomocny post
    Poziom 23  
    Z pdfu wynika że jest to czterobitowy mikrokontroler z przeznaczeniem do zdalnego sterowania. Można go prawdopodobnie programować na różne standardy, więc nie ma pewności że nadaje w SIRC.
  • Poziom 14  
    załączam nagrany sygnał z pilota. Mi wygląda to jednak na sony, ale proszę o potwierdzenie kogoś bardziej doświadczonego.
  • Pomocny post
    VIP Zasłużony dla elektroda
    A mółbyś dorzucić do obrazka czasy? Ułatwiłoby to znacznie analizę
  • Pomocny post
    VIP Zasłużony dla elektroda
    SIRC ma nośną 40KHz, standard NECa ma 38KHz, a RC5 36Khz, może tym by się pokierował i sprawdził które częstotliwości przepuszcza odbiornik?
  • Pomocny post
    Poziom 23  
    A jaka jest nośna powie Ci częstotliwość rezonatora ceramicznego. Częstotliwość nośna jest uzyskiwana poprzez dzielenie częstotliwości oscylatora przez 8 lub 12. Może być to 456kHz i 12 dla NEC, lub 480 i 12 dla Sony. Mogą być też inne kombinacje z dzielnikiem 8.
  • Poziom 14  
    Kwarc jest 455kHz (przynajmniej tak wynika z opisu: B455 E20, producenta nie rozszyfrowałem, jest to kółko z literą M w prawej górnej ćwiartce tego koła), więc wychodzi nośna 38kHz, a więc nie jest to ani rc5 ani sirc (wiec moze nec :P). No nic nie będę Wam zawracał głowy, najlepiej będzie jak kupie jakiegoś pilota uniwersalnego co nadaje w rc5 i będzie po sprawie :) Dziękuję za pomoc!

    Pozdrawiam!
  • Poziom 22  
    A wie ktoś może w jakim standardzie nadaje pilot od yamahy dvd s510?